Mumbai: Mixed global cues and a recovery in the domestic currency helped the S&P BSE Sensex eke out meagre gains, ending the day just below the 35,000-mark on Tuesday.

Sectoral stocks on the BSE, including IT, TECK (technology, entertainment and media) and consumers durables gained over 1 per cent each, while the banking and finance counters slipped.
